Output 2515108f550d34c1f5d3f5fef9f17ce7280d6ce0fa1e734b6d018b42ca3df789:96

value
68283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2bc905d37a0deb86094b7521491bf2858a8b55 OP_EQUAL
address
37BAvJgnQjaqjs2bj7Yx4sMeZZLKHNMvrG
transaction
2515108f550d34c1f5d3f5fef9f17ce7280d6ce0fa1e734b6d018b42ca3df789
spent
true